A freshly retold animal fable about heroism, hope, and community, from award-winning creators Leah Henderson and Magaly MoralesAcross oceans, lands, and skiesIn whispers, shouts, and in many different languagesthe story of the little hummingbird of the Great Forest can always be heardThe story of the little hummingbird has been told around the world in many forms and across many cultures, believed to have originated among the Indigenous Quecha people of modern-day Ecuador. In this spin on the globally popular legend, when a disastrous forest fire threatens the Great Forest, the hummingbird must inspire all the animals to work together to save their homes.Lyrically told by Leah Henderson and vividly illustrated by Magaly Morales, this tale of bravery against seemingly insurmountable odds and a community working together to overcome adversity is a reminder that no challenge is too great, and that even the smallest of us can make a world of difference.Includes an author’s note, as well as back matter on the origins of the folktale and facts about hummingbirds.
